Scope The Naval Surface Warfare Center, Panama City Division, FL, (NSWC PCD) has a requirement for Testing and Evaluation (T&E) for electromagnetic interference per MIL-STD-461 and MIL-STD-1399 Section 407 requirements on three (3) Commercially Available Off-The-Shelf (COTS) Under Breathing Apparatus (UBA). Requirement 1. Test Plan (CDRL A001) - See SOW 2. Optional Test Events with Test Report a). Option 1 (T&E: MIL-STD-461:RE101, RE102, RS101 and RS103) (CDRL A002) - See SOW b). Option 2 (T&E: MIL-STD-1399: SECTION 407) (CDRL A003) - See SOW 3.
